AI Tools that transform your day

AIHelperBot

AIHelperBot

AIHelperBot simplifies SQL query generation, optimization, and learning, empowering users to gain insights effortlessly and enhance database efficiency.

AIHelperBot Screenshot

What is AIHelperBot?

AIHelperBot is an innovative, AI-powered SQL and NoSQL query generation tool designed to simplify the process of working with databases. It allows users to create, optimize, and manage SQL queries effortlessly, regardless of their experience level. With a user-friendly interface and advanced AI capabilities, AIHelperBot caters to a wide range of users, from beginners to seasoned professionals, helping them save time, reduce errors, and gain valuable data insights.

Features

AIHelperBot boasts a comprehensive suite of features that enhance the user experience and streamline database management. Here are some of the standout features:

1. SQL Query Generation

  • Natural Language Processing: Users can generate SQL queries using everyday language, making it accessible for those without extensive SQL knowledge.
  • Support for NoSQL: The tool can also generate NoSQL queries, broadening its applicability.

2. SQL Query Optimization

  • Step-by-Step Optimization: AIHelperBot provides innovative suggestions for optimizing SQL queries to improve performance and resource usage.
  • Performance Insights: Users can see how optimizations impact query execution time and resource consumption.

3. Syntax Validation and Error Fixing

  • Automated Error Detection: The tool scans queries for syntax errors and provides suggestions for fixes.
  • Explanatory Feedback: Suggested fixes come with explanations to help users understand the errors and learn from them.

4. Query Simplification

  • Readability Improvements: AIHelperBot can simplify complex queries by removing redundant patterns and unnecessary clauses, making them easier to understand.
  • Error Reduction: Simplified queries are less prone to errors, enhancing overall database management.

5. Formatting Options

  • Custom Formatting Rules: Users can format SQL queries according to specific readability standards, ensuring consistency across teams.
  • Improved Collaboration: Well-formatted queries facilitate better collaboration among team members.

6. SQL Query Explanation

  • Detailed Breakdown: AIHelperBot provides comprehensive explanations of SQL queries, summarizing their purpose and visualizing results.
  • Multilingual Support: Explanations can be offered in the user’s native language, making it more accessible.

7. Migration and Conversion

  • Cross-Database Conversion: Users can convert SQL queries from one database system to another (e.g., from Oracle to PostgreSQL) seamlessly.
  • NoSQL Compatibility: The tool also supports the conversion of NoSQL queries.

8. Database Index Generation

  • Performance Optimization: AIHelperBot can generate database indexes to ensure optimal performance, considering existing indexes for efficiency.

9. Data Analytics

  • Interactive Data Queries: Users can drag and drop data to ask questions directly, enabling immediate insights without involving the data team.

10. Data Source Integration

  • Easy Data Source Addition: Users can add data sources with a single click, enhancing the accuracy of generated queries.
  • Support for Large Schemas: The tool can handle large database schemas without exhausting the AI's context window.

11. Helper Tools

  • Run Query: Execute generated queries directly on connected data sources with a simple click.
  • View Diff: Compare original and optimized queries to see changes made by AI.
  • Query Adjustment: Make small changes to generated queries easily.
  • VS Code Integration: Edit queries using a full-fledged VS Code editor for advanced adjustments.

Use Cases

AIHelperBot is designed to cater to various user groups, each with unique needs and requirements. Here are some common use cases:

1. Developers

  • Accelerate Development: Developers can quickly generate and optimize SQL queries, significantly speeding up the development process.
  • Enhanced Productivity: With AIHelperBot, developers can focus on building applications rather than debugging complex queries.

2. Data Analysts

  • Efficient Query Generation: Data analysts can generate complex queries quickly, enabling them to retrieve data insights without extensive SQL knowledge.
  • Direct Access to Data: Analysts can run queries directly on connected data sources, streamlining the data analysis process.

3. Business Users

  • Simplified Data Retrieval: Business users can gain insights from data without needing deep SQL expertise, empowering them to make data-driven decisions.
  • Real-Time Insights: AIHelperBot allows business users to access data insights immediately, reducing dependency on data teams.

4. SQL Learners

  • Learning by Doing: Beginners can learn SQL effectively by generating queries and receiving explanations for their structure and function.
  • Gentle Learning Curve: The user-friendly interface and supportive features make it easy for learners to grasp SQL concepts.

5. Small Business Owners

  • Cost-Effective Database Management: Small business owners can optimize their databases without hiring specialists, saving time and money.
  • Improved Operations: By using AIHelperBot, small businesses can enhance their database management processes, leading to better overall operations.

6. Data Scientists

  • Efficiency and Accuracy: Data scientists can significantly reduce the time spent debugging and optimizing queries, making AIHelperBot an essential part of their toolkit.
  • Complex Query Handling: The tool enables data scientists to handle complex database operations with ease.

Pricing

AIHelperBot offers flexible pricing plans to accommodate various user needs and budgets. While specific pricing details are not provided, the tool is designed to be affordable and accessible, ensuring that both individuals and organizations can benefit from its powerful features.

The pricing structure typically includes:

  • Free Trial: Users can get started for free, allowing them to explore the tool's capabilities before committing to a paid plan.
  • Subscription Plans: Various subscription tiers may be available, offering different levels of access and features based on user requirements.
  • Enterprise Solutions: Customized plans for larger organizations may also be offered, providing tailored features and support.

Comparison with Other Tools

AIHelperBot stands out in the crowded market of SQL query management tools due to its unique combination of features and capabilities. Here are some points of comparison with other tools:

1. User-Friendly Interface

  • Many SQL tools can be complex and intimidating for beginners. AIHelperBot's intuitive interface simplifies the process, making it accessible for users of all skill levels.

2. AI-Powered Features

  • Unlike traditional SQL tools, AIHelperBot leverages advanced AI technology to generate, optimize, and explain queries, providing a level of assistance that is unmatched in the market.

3. Comprehensive Functionality

  • AIHelperBot combines various functionalities—query generation, optimization, error fixing, and explanation—into a single platform, reducing the need for multiple tools.

4. Support for NoSQL

  • While many SQL tools focus solely on SQL databases, AIHelperBot's support for NoSQL queries broadens its applicability, catering to a wider range of users.

5. Learning Opportunities

  • AIHelperBot not only assists users in generating and optimizing queries but also educates them in the process, enhancing their SQL skills over time.

FAQ

What is AIHelperBot?

AIHelperBot is an affordable, easy-to-use SQL multi-tool designed for both SQL beginners and professionals. It assists users in producing precise SQL or NoSQL queries while saving time and resources.

Who is AIHelperBot for?

AIHelperBot caters to a diverse range of users, including developers, data analysts, business users, SQL learners, experienced SQL practitioners, and small business owners, each with different needs.

Why choose AIHelperBot?

AIHelperBot stands out due to its unprecedented accuracy, easy handling of large database schemas, instant result streaming, and comprehensive support for both SQL and NoSQL queries.

How does AIHelperBot help users learn SQL?

AIHelperBot provides detailed explanations of generated queries, allowing users to understand their structure and function while learning SQL effectively through hands-on experience.

Can AIHelperBot handle large database schemas?

Yes, AIHelperBot is designed to work seamlessly with large database schemas without exhausting the AI's context window, ensuring accurate query generation.

Is there a free trial available?

Yes, users can get started for free, allowing them to explore AIHelperBot's capabilities before committing to a paid plan.

In summary, AIHelperBot is a powerful and versatile tool that revolutionizes the way users interact with SQL and NoSQL databases. Its AI-driven features, user-friendly interface, and comprehensive functionality make it an invaluable asset for anyone looking to streamline their database management and enhance their SQL skills.

Ready to try it out?

Go to AIHelperBot External link